EK at LGW seems to have become very strict with cabin baggage recently. Cabin baggage weighed while checking in last week.It was a standard B&R so nothing out of the ordinary .

I've nevery had cabin baggage weighed at LGW before at least in J. I was told that there were strict instructions Re cabin baggage.


My bag was just around 5kg so I was fine but there was another pax in the J queue ahead of me who was told that his cabin bag was 1 or 2 kg over and had to either repack or check the bag in and was very upset.So they seem to very strict nowadays.


In a way its good that they implement their own rules well but I wish they were consistent in implementing it.Sometimes you can't even find space in the hat rack even in J as some people like to carry even the kitchen sink
